This is my 2021 Grail CFSL 8 with the Di2 all geared up for the Day Across MN. These bikes get a lot of hate for the double decker bars. After riding with it for many years, I can understand it because in the ultra scene, I’d love to be able to run aero bars. However this bike has been my go-to for all my gravel racing and has been through many ultra-distance rides and races. It was even my daily commuter when it was my only bike. It’s such a solid bike I love it. No issues. Yeah it’s scuffed up a bit but I take meticulous care of it. Has about 18k miles on it. Lot of replacement parts and she’s still going strong. My wife and I own several Canyons and I stand by their reliability.
